An asteroid is a small, rocky object that orbits the Sun, primarily found in the asteroid belt between Mars and Jupiter, though they can be found throughout the solar system. Ranging in size from a few meters to hundreds of kilometers across, asteroids are remnants from the early formation of the solar system over 4.5 billion years ago. Studying these ancient space rocks provides valuable insights into planetary formation and the composition of the early solar system. Asteroids also draw scientific and public interest due to their potential impact risk to Earth and their promise as future targets for space missions and resource exploration.
